According to one embodiment, an illumination device includes a light source, clad, and a plurality of cores. The clad includes a first edge at a light source side, a second edge opposite to the first edge, and a plurality of grooves formed by a plurality of partitions extending in parallel to each other from the first edge to the second edge. The cores are accommodated in the grooves, and each core includes an incident surface on which light from the light source is incident and an exit surface exposed from the groove to emit the light incident on the incident surface.

According to one embodiment, an imaging display system includes an imaging device and a display device, which operate synchronously with each other. The imaging display system includes a control device. The control device is configured to measure light exposure when the imaging device captures an image and determine whether the measured light exposure is insufficient, and control the display device to decrease a refresh rate and the imaging device to prolong an exposure time, when determined that the light exposure is insufficient. The first scanning time for the imaging device to scan the image and the second scanning time required for the display device to scan the display panel are constant.

According to an aspect, a display device includes a display unit in which a plurality of pixels are arranged in a matrix along two directions intersecting with each other. Each of the pixels includes three sub-pixels corresponding to three of four colors including a first color, a second color, a third color, and a fourth color. An area of one sub-pixel among the three sub-pixels is larger than the area of each of the other two sub-pixels. A sub-pixel of the fourth color is one of the other two sub-pixels. Pixels each including the sub-pixel of the fourth color are not adjacent to each other in at least one of the two directions in the display unit.

A display device includes an image display panel on which pixels are arranged, a backlight which lights the image display panel from a rear of the image display panel, a first device which controls the backlight, and a second device which controls the image display panel. The first device generates an image signal, outputs the image signal to the second device, determines a light source lighting amount of the backlight on the basis of the image signal by blocks obtained by dividing a display surface of the image display panel and luminance distribution information on the backlight stored in advance, and controls the backlight by the light source lighting amount. The second device acquires the image signal, converts the image signal to a display signal for controlling display of the image display panel, and controls the image display panel.
